Isaac in Chinese

Isaac in Chinese is 以撒 — Isaac means in the Bible, the son of Abraham and Sarah, and father of Esau and Jacob.

Isaac in Chinese

以撒
proper noun
Pronounced: Yǐ sā
(biblical character) The son of Abraham and Sarah, father of Esau and Jacob, from whom the Hebrew people trace their descent.

What does "Isaac" mean?

  1. name In the Bible, the son of Abraham and Sarah, and father of Esau and Jacob.
    "The story of Isaac appears in the Book of Genesis."
  2. name A male given name from Hebrew, also used as a surname.
    "Isaac Newton made major discoveries in physics."
